Originalmente inviato da
nicomelot
io ho risolto questo problema
cosi XD
Premetto di aver installato la versione 2.8.4 di wordpress e non riesco ad aggiornare in automatico i plugin.
Ho seguito la guida a cui facevi riferimento, ma ne alla riga 182 e ne a qualsiasi altra parte del 'file.php', non compare
Codice PHP:
$filename = preg_replace('|\..*$|', '.tmp', $filename);
$filename = $dir . wp_unique_filename($dir, $filename);
touch($filename);
return $filename;
ma bensì ho il seguente codice:
Codice PHP:
/**
* {@internal Missing Short Description}}
*
* @since unknown
*
* @param unknown_type $file
* @param unknown_type $allowed_files
* @return unknown
*/
function validate_file_to_edit( $file, $allowed_files = '' ) {
per quanto riguarda gli errori visualizzati durante il tentativo di aggiornamento dei plugin, riporto alcuni esempi:
- Akismet
Codice PHP:
Scaricamento aggiornamento da http://downloads.wordpress.org/plugin/akismet.2.3.0.zip.
Scompattamento dell’aggiornamento.
Archivi incompatibile PCLZIP_ERR_BAD_FORMAT (-10) : Unable to find End of Central Dir Record signature
- Google XML Sitemaps
Codice PHP:
Scaricamento aggiornamento da http://downloads.wordpress.org/plugin/google-sitemap-generator.3.2.4.zip.
Scompattamento dell’aggiornamento.
Archivi incompatibile PCLZIP_ERR_BAD_FORMAT (-10) : Unable to find End of Central Dir Record signature